11 / 30 page 點晶科技股份有限公司 SILICON TOUCH TECHNOLOGY INC. DM164 8x3-CHANNEL CONSTANT CURRENT LED DRIVERS Version:A.002 Page 10 Serial Data Interface The DM164 includes a flexible data transfer interface. The data can be transferred from DIN pin to the shift registers at either the rising edge of DCK or the falling edge of DCK depending on the signal DCKPH. After all data are clocked in, a high level LTH signal can transfer the serial data to the data latches (Level Sensitive). The serial data format can be 192-bit or 384-bit wide, depending on the operating mode of the device. Operating Modes The DM164 has two operating modes depending on the signal MSEL. Table 1 shows the available operating modes. When MSEL = H, the device operates at the D&G mode. D&G mode is used to set dot correction data and global brightness control data after IC power up or any time. When MSEL = L, the device becomes GD mode. GD mode is used to set grayscale PWM data after D&G mode. Table 1. Two Operating Modes MSEL MODE SHIFT REGISTER H Dot Correction Data & Global Brightness Control Data Input Mode (D&G mode) 192-bit L Grayscale PWM Data Input Mode (GD mode) 384-bit D&G Mode Data Format At D&G mode, dot correction data of all channels and global brightness control data of different colors are transferred into the chip at the same time. The complete dot correction data format consists of 24 x 7-bit and the global brightness control data of three different colors consists of 3 x 8-bit. The total shift registers width at D&G mode is 192-bit. All data is clocked in with MSB first. Figure 1 shows the D&G mode data format.
